app/internal/window: [android] re-apply view state lost on rotate etc.

Android can re-create our Activity and GioView at any time, losing view
and activity state such as the current cursor. Further, setting state
while there is no GioView attached is lost.

Track the current and unapplied state, and apply it when a GioView is
available.
